+#include "base/platform_thread.h"
+
+#include "base/logging.h"
+#include "base/win_util.h"
+
+#include "nsThreadUtils.h"
+
+namespace {
+
+DWORD __stdcall ThreadFunc(void* closure) {
+ PlatformThread::Delegate* delegate =
+ static_cast<PlatformThread::Delegate*>(closure);
+ delegate->ThreadMain();
+ return 0;
+}
+
+} // namespace
+
+// static
+PlatformThreadId PlatformThread::CurrentId() { return GetCurrentThreadId(); }
+
+// static
+void PlatformThread::YieldCurrentThread() { ::Sleep(0); }
+
+// static
+void PlatformThread::Sleep(int duration_ms) { ::Sleep(duration_ms); }
+
+// static
+void PlatformThread::SetName(const char* name) {
+ // Using NS_SetCurrentThreadName, as opposed to using platform APIs directly,
+ // also sets the thread name on the PRThread wrapper, and allows us to
+ // retrieve it using PR_GetThreadName.
+ NS_SetCurrentThreadName(name);
+}
+
+// static
+bool PlatformThread::Create(size_t stack_size, Delegate* delegate,
+ PlatformThreadHandle* thread_handle) {
+ unsigned int flags = 0;
+ if (stack_size > 0) {
+ flags = STACK_SIZE_PARAM_IS_A_RESERVATION;
+ } else {
+ stack_size = 0;
+ }
+
+ // Using CreateThread here vs _beginthreadex makes thread creation a bit
+ // faster and doesn't require the loader lock to be available. Our code will
+ // have to work running on CreateThread() threads anyway, since we run code
+ // on the Windows thread pool, etc. For some background on the difference:
+ // http://www.microsoft.com/msj/1099/win32/win321099.aspx
+ *thread_handle =
+ CreateThread(NULL, stack_size, ThreadFunc, delegate, flags, NULL);
+ return *thread_handle != NULL;
+}
+
+// static
+bool PlatformThread::CreateNonJoinable(size_t stack_size, Delegate* delegate) {
+ PlatformThreadHandle thread_handle;
+ bool result = Create(stack_size, delegate, &thread_handle);
+ CloseHandle(thread_handle);
+ return result;
+}
+
+// static
+void PlatformThread::Join(PlatformThreadHandle thread_handle) {
+ DCHECK(thread_handle);
+
+ // Wait for the thread to exit. It should already have terminated but make
+ // sure this assumption is valid.
+ DWORD result = WaitForSingleObject(thread_handle, INFINITE);
+ DCHECK_EQ(WAIT_OBJECT_0, result);
+
+ CloseHandle(thread_handle);
+}
